I picked up an 8 channel Eyesurve ION NVR from Nelly's to run as a back up to my Blue Iris machine and have to say that I am really happy and impressed with its performance. I'm recording 7 Hikvision cameras 24/7 (5 2032 bullets, 1 exir and 1 cube). This NVR is compatible with Hikvision, EYEsurv and Dahua IP cameras but currently does not record on motion with Hikvision cameras. I picked up a 3 TB hard drive and a cheap wireless mouse to compliment it and so far this little guy has been perfect! I highly recommend it as a backup NVR. It is small and easy to hide and also has an Android an iPhone app which allows you to view recordings and live cameras. It needs to be plugged into the wall for power and also into your router / switch. Currently the NVR does not record in 3MP but it will in 1080P.
